What does Jaxon Smith-Njigba’s recent contract extension with the Seattle Seahawks signify for the future of the NFL? It marks a pivotal moment in professional football, as Smith-Njigba has officially become the highest-paid receiver in NFL history, signing a four-year, $168.6 million contract extension. This deal includes over $120 million in guarantees, reflecting both the Seahawks’ confidence in his abilities and his remarkable performance on the field.
In 2025, Smith-Njigba led the NFL with an impressive 1,793 receiving yards, a feat that not only showcases his talent but also his integral role in the Seahawks’ success. He set franchise records for receptions with 119 and receiving yards in a single season, accounting for a staggering 44% of Seattle’s total receiving yards that year. His contributions were vital in helping the Seahawks clinch the Super Bowl LX title, further solidifying his legacy within the team.
Smith-Njigba’s performance has not gone unnoticed; he was named the AP Offensive Player of the Year in 2025, a testament to his hard work and dedication. He also led the league with 27 catches of at least 20 yards and 8 catches of 40-plus yards, demonstrating his ability to make significant plays when it matters most. As one source noted, “Smith-Njigba is an embodiment of the ‘Mission Over Bulls—‘ mantra the Seahawks adopted last season during their run to Super Bowl LX.” This speaks volumes about his character and the impact he has on his teammates.
The Seahawks’ decision to extend Smith-Njigba’s contract comes after they exercised his fifth-year option on his rookie contract, indicating their long-term commitment to him. The average annual salary of $42.15 million makes him a standout figure in the league, and it sets a new benchmark for future contracts among wide receivers.
